ECU Power Source Circuit: Procedure

  1. CHECK DRIVING SUPPORT ECU ASSEMBLY (B VOLTAGE) 
    1. Discon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.

    2. Turn the power switch on (IG).
    3.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Voltage

      Tester Connection Switch Condition Specified Condition
      H5-30 (B) - Body ground Power switch on (IG) 11 to 14 V

    4. Recon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.

    NG → See step   3 

    OK: Go to next step 

  2.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(DRIVING SUPPORT ECU ASSEMBLY - BODY GROUND) 
    1. Discon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.

    2.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ance (Check for Open)

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      H5-25 (GND) - Body ground Always Below 1 Ω

    3. Recon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.

    NG → RE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(DRIVING SUPPORT ECU ASSEMBLY - BODY GROUND) 

    OK → See step   8 

  3. INSPECT IN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Y 
    1. Remove the instrument panel junction block assembly.

    2.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      2E-1 - 2B-2 Always 10 kΩ or higher
      2E-1 - 2B-2 Auxiliary battery voltage applied between terminals 2B-25 and 2B-6 Below 1 Ω

    3. Reinstall the instrument panel junction block assembly.

    NG → REPLACE IN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Y 

    OK: Go to next step 

  4.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(DRIVING SUPPORT ECU - IN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K) 
    1. Discon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.
    2. Discon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.
    3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ance (Check for Open)

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      H5-30 (B) - 2B-2 Always Below 1 Ω
    4. Recon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.
    5. Reconnect the driving support ECU assembly connector.

    NG → RE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(DRIVING SUPPORT ECU - IN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K) 

    OK: Go to next step 

  5.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K POWER SOURCE CIRCUIT) 
    1. Discon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

    2.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Voltage

      Tester Connection Switch Condition Specified Condition
      2E-1 - Body ground Always 11 to 14 V

    3. Recon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

    NG → RE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Y - AUXILIARY BATTERY) 

    OK: Go to next step 

  6.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Y - BODY GROUND) 
    1. Discon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

    2.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ance (Check for Open)

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      2B-6 - Body ground Always Below 1 Ω

    3. Recon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

    NG → RE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Y - BODY GROUND) 

    OK: Go to next step 

  7.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(POWER MANAGEMENT CONTROL ECU - INSTRUMENT PANEL J/B ASSEMBLY) 
    1. Disconnect the power management control ECU connector.
    2. Discon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.
    3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

      Standard Resistance (Check for Open)

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      2B-25 - H4-2 (IG1D) Always Below 1 Ω

      Standard Resistance (Check for Short)

      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
      2B-25 or H4-2 (IG1D)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her
    4. Reconnect the power management control ECU connector.
    5. Recon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

    NG → RE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(POWER MANAGEMENT CONTROL ECU - INSTRUMENT PANEL J/B ASSEMBLY) 

    OK → See step   9 

  8. PROCEED TO NEXT SUSPECTED AREA SHOWN IN PROBLEM SYMPTOMS TABLE. Refer to  PROBLEM SYMPTOMS TABLE [08/2012 - ] 
  9. GO TO SMART ACCESS SYSTEM WITH PUSH-BUTTON START. Refer to  HOW TO PROCEED WITH TROUBLESHOOTING [08/2012 - ]
